Wolfgang Netzer

Wolfgang Netzer is a virtuoso player of the six, seven, ten and twelve string guitars. He also plays the traditional Arabic instrument, the Oud. He has been performing around the world for the past 25 years.

In his musical career he has also composed many scores for film and television projects including Jane’s Journey; the title music of Michael Moore’s Fahrenheit 9/11 and more than 30 documentaries.

He has studied music in a variety of exotic locations including Rio de Janeiro Brazil, Cairo, Istanbul and Tunis. In the latter three locations he was a student where he learned more about Arabian music.
